Originally Posted by 99FormulaM6
you can change the lighting of the cobalt guages? it doesnt say anything about it on any of the sites i checked
The Phantom Gauges are lit by a bulb in the back that plugs in. The bulb is clear but the package came with red and green translucent covers for the bulbs. Others have colored the bulbs by spraying a kandy over them. I sprayed nightshades on mine to darken them up.
